Brand History
1. 1927: Launch of the first production car, the ÖV 4. 2. 1944: Introduction of the PV444 model, which enabled international market expansion. 3. 1959: Implementation of the three-point seatbelt, which became an industry standard. 4. 1999: Sale of the passenger car division to Ford Motor Company. 5. 2010: Acquisition by Zhejiang Geely Holding Group.

Ecology
The company is actively implementing a full electrification strategy for its model range and utilizes recycled materials in the production of interior components. Technologies to reduce CO2 emissions at manufacturing sites have been implemented.
Brand Authentication
The Volvo Genuine Parts protection system is used, featuring unique identifiers on the packaging. Part markings are applied via laser engraving or impact stamping, depending on the component type. The batch code consists of a 10-digit numeric format.
